Friday, May 30, 2008

Life In Tucson

So since the Phoenix lander touched down, I know I'll be spending some time here for a while.

What does this mean for MAS, mostly that I'll be juggling bug fixes with supporting the tool. The good news is when I'm not supporting the mission I should have plenty of time for Bugs and less likelihood of getting distracted.

The past few days have been was amazing and I'm glad I have been involved in this project for the past 3 years.

The fun part is I get to have 2 laptops, my normal mac and a windows machine. What this means is I got to experience the joy of installing bugzilla and bzr on a windows machine. It was as fun as a root canal!

But it works and because of that I was able to knock out a bunch of bugs. I've also done some cool stuff with YUI that I need to post, specifically animating the scroll bar of the whole window! It looks like there are some bugs in IE so I'm gonna fix that, publish it and then yank it out. Because our designers don't like it. But it was still fun to write an extension to the YUI animation class and I think it would be very educational for anyone who wants to write their own.

I've also had a few other wrestling matches with YUI, in the end I'm not sure who won, but YUI did was it was supposed to and it made my life easier, so maybe we both won.

Long story short...

YAY the Phoenix has Landed! YAY YUI ROXORS!

1 comment:

  1. Hahaha, yeah, unfortunately installing Bugzilla on Windows is a less-than-picnic-level experience. I usually blame Windows for that, and Windows users usually blame Bugzilla for that. :-D

    Seriously, if it wasn't such a crappy development platform, or if it ever decides to join the 21st Century where we have centralized software repositories, things would be better.